			<description>Saint Paul based solutions provider, SunLeaf Solar introduces the new SunLeaf Pro, an iPad Solar Charger. SunLeaf's solar charger is a USB-based device which plugs into an electronic gadget like the iPad, iPhone or GoPro and can fold up to an eighth of its size. It is convenient, portable and can provide power anywhere there is sunlight. In ideal conditions, the SunLeaf Pro is capable of fully charging an iPad in under 7 hours. An iPhone would charge fully in under three hours.</description>

			<description>Hurlybird Media today released Putting Pal 1.2 for iPhone users. This ingenious app uses augmented reality to help golfers improve their putting game. Like other green readers, Putting Pal 1.2 shows users the break direction and slope of the green, then it uses that information to go where other green readers can't. With a few simple adjustments, golfers get real-time, visual feedback about their shot, including ball trajectory and required swing strength.</description>

			<description>Databright Management Systems today released EcoCense 1.0 for iPhone, iPod touch and iPad users. EcoCense instantly calculates all the financial and ecological cost savings between two vehicles or for household efficiency upgrades. Time to recoup investment, tonnage of CO2 saved and monthly, annual and payback term savings are noted, so consumers can make informed green purchasing decisions. Users merely have to input the figures and tap the Calculate button for instant results.</description>

			<description>iPad app highlights the planet's glory, challenges. Open Door Networks Inc. and Project A Inc. today announced that they are shipping Earth Envi HD through the iTunes App Store. The iPad-specific app, timed to arrive for the 40th Earth Day, provides access to thousands of Web-based photos of planet Earth from outer space. It also includes access to month-by-month climate maps and over a decade's worth of photos and articles from NASA's Earth Observatory.</description>

			<description>Williamsburg based Hunter Research and Technology today announces greenMeter 2.0 for iPhone and iPod Touch. greenMeter computes a vehicle's power and fuel usage characteristics to help drivers increase efficiency, reduce fuel consumption and cost, and lower environmental impact. Results are displayed in real time while driving, to provide instantaneous feedback, and can be shown with U.S. or metric units. Version 2.0 adds three new eco-driving efficiency displays.</description>

			<description>Siavash Ghamaty introduces Recycler, the first recycling-friendly iPhone application for free download. Recycler untangles those complicated and seemingly arbitrary PEC plastic codes on the bottom of your recyclables. Acceptable plastic recycling codes vary from location to location. Recycler allows users to add their location's codes into an attractive interface that makes a green-conscious lifestyle easy.</description>
